what do minerals provide for bone
make bone stiff and able to support structures
high strength under compression
what does collagen provide for bone
gives bone some flexibility and reduces risk of fracture
high strength under tension
what is bone turnover
constant process
balance between bone removal and formation
process of bone formation
osteoclasts break down old bone
osteoblasts build new bone
what are osteoclasts
large multinucleate cells derived from haemotopoietic stem cells
